That was my first thought, too. I have bred heritage line Delawares for years, though I have only one remaining 11 year old hen now. They don't have distinct enough markings for Delawares. The leg color could be a substandard leg color, but usually, those look sort of greenish, not just white, on some hatchery Delawares. Hmm, a mystery!
